  • 词组搭配

    wipe someone's eye

    (Brit. informal, dated)get the better of someone

    (英,非正式,旧)胜过某人

    wipe the floor with

    (informal)inflict a humiliating defeat on

    (非正式)使…遭受耻辱性失败

    they wiped the floor with us in a 3–0 win.

    他们3比0大败我方。

    wipe the slate clean

    forgive or forget past faults or offences; make a fresh start

    原谅过去的错误;忘却以往的冒犯;重新开始

    wipe something off

    subtract an amount from a value or debt

    扣除价值额(或债务额)

    the crash wiped 24 per cent off stock prices.

    这次崩盘使股价跌了24%。

    wipe someone out

    kill a large number of people

    杀死大批人

    the plague had wiped out whole villages.

    瘟疫夺去了全村所有人的生命。

    (一般作 be wiped out)ruin someone financially

    在财务上毁掉某人

    (informal)exhaust or intoxicate someone

    (非正式)使某人筋疲力尽;使喝醉

    wipe something out

    eliminate something completely

    彻底消灭某物

    their life savings were wiped out.

    他们一生的积蓄全用光了。

    wipe out

    To destroy or be destroyed completely.

    消灭:彻底摧毁或被彻底破坏

    &I{Slang} To murder.

    &I{【俚语】} 杀死,谋杀

    &I{Sports} To lose one's balance and fall or jump off a surfboard.

    &I{【体育运动】} 被浪打翻:失去平衡,然后从冲浪板上翻跌下来或跳下来

  • 同义词辨析

    clean, clear, sweep, dust, mop, wipe, scrub

    这些动词均有"使干净"之意。

    • clean: 是这些动词中最常用的词,指将某物或某处的污物等清除掉,弄干净。
    • clear: 指清除不要的东西。
    • sweep: 指用扫帚等进行清扫,也用作比喻。
    • dust: 指将积落在物体表面的尘土抹去、掸掉或擦去以保干净。
    • mop: 侧重指用拖把擦洗地板,有时也指擦干净或擦去。
    • wipe: 多指用布、纸等物把东西擦净,也指擦掉某物。
    • scrub: 指用硬刷、肥皂或水用力地擦洗某物。

  • 常用俚语

    • wipe the floor with somebody
      把某人打得一败涂地,轻易地大败某人

      That bum? The champ'll wipe up the floor with him.

      那个家伙?冠军准会轻而易举地把他打得一败涂地。

      Our team wiped the floor with the visiting team.

      我队大胜了客队。
